12.07.2015 Views

Formal Verification of Synchronous Models: An Industrial Application ...

Formal Verification of Synchronous Models: An Industrial Application ...

Formal Verification of Synchronous Models: An Industrial Application 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

What are Theorem Provers?• Available Since Late 1980’s– Widely Used on Security Systems• Use Rules <strong>of</strong> Inference to Prove New Properties– Also Consider All Combinations <strong>of</strong> Inputs and States– Also Equivalent to Testing with an Infinite Set <strong>of</strong> Test Cases– Generate <strong>An</strong> Unprovable Pro<strong>of</strong> Obligation if a Property is False• Not Limited by State Space– Applicable to Almost <strong>An</strong>y <strong>Formal</strong> Specification• Limitations– Require Experience - About Six Months to Become Pr<strong>of</strong>icient– Constructing Pro<strong>of</strong>s is Labor Intensive© 2006 Rockwell Collins, Inc. All rights reserved.26

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!